(2) Procedures
The procedures are as illustrated below.
(a) Processing cable end
1) Place each wire end of the VCTF
cable/flexible cable on the guide having
the same color as the wire.
(b) Building T-branch connection (VCTF cable/flexible cable)
5)-1 When using a terminal block for T-branch connection
When connecting a VCTF cable/flexible cable to a terminal block, connect the wires so that the wire colors
match with the corresponding terminals.

*1 When connecting a dedicated flat cable to a terminal block
(e.g. Using a VCTF cable for the trunk line and dedicated flat
cables for branch lines), match "+24V", "DA", "DB", and "24G"
printed on the dedicated flat cable with the corresponding colors
of the VCTF cable (flexible cable) as shown in the table to right.
Split the dedicated flat cable so that "+24V", "DA", "DB", and
"24G" cables may be independent.
2) Close the cover so that the VCTF
cable/flexible cable may be held
between both sides of the cover.
When the wiring is correct, the green
wire is visible through the notch
window.
If a red, white, or black wire is visible
through the window, open the cover
and correct the wiring.
Incorrect wiring may cause failure of
the module.
Green: Correct wiring
Red, white, or black: Incorrect wiring
